The investigation process against Dani Alves continues its course in Spain. The Brazil full-back remains in pre-trial detention as he is investigated for an alleged sexual assault that took place at a nightclub in December 2022 .
More than a month after the complaint, the Court of Instruction number 15 of Barcelona has collected the statement of the people involved, the attendants and the employees of the premises, in addition to examining the security images and examining the reports of police.
In this sense, the evidence collected so far places Dani Alves in a difficult position, which ensures, according to his version, that the sexual relations that took place inside the bathroom of the VIP area were consented .
However, the victim accuses them of having been forced and the main proof of this accusation against the Brazilian is the fact that he made a “forceful” and “persistent” statement when maintaining in court the same version as he did to the Mossos. . d’Esquadra the same night and two days after the events of the sexual assault suffered and blows allegedly given by the player after having resisted.
There, the complainant explained that she saw “how they touched my friends” and also realized “how close I was to them”. She also explained that the player grabbed her from behind while they were dancing and that Alves said things in her ear that she didn’t understand, because he did it in Portuguese. “From behind he took my hand and put it on his penis and I pulled it out. He did it twice, the second time with great force and I pulled him out again. it disgusted me “, he explained. He also assured that it made him feel helpless, because “we were far from each other ”.
“I collapsed, I started to get very scared and with nothing happening, I thought, what if he puts something in my drink? “, he underlined in his story. Moreover, he wonderedWhat if I leave here now and when I leave, they catch us or something? she expressed after telling police that Alves had brought out a bottle of cava to invite them over, but she and her friends refused and left the glasses on the table untouched. “I insisted and it was very heavy”, explained the woman who added that “it disgusted me”.

In defense of Dani Alves, they consider that there was no alleged harassment of the victim and his friends in the 20 minutes preceding the entrance to the toilets. All this based on footage from security cameras in the VIP area. They point out that duringFor 20 long minutes, a group of five people can be seen conversing in a playful and festive way surrounded by many people in an open space, which is far from being the context and the theater of environmental intimidation that the notorious jurisprudence of our courts consider as sufficient to break the capacity of the victim and his capacity for self-determination ”.
For this reason, they believe that the images “refute in the most radical way the climate of terror described by the plaintiff”, and they question the statement made, since we see that Alves enters the bathroom and two minutes later the plaintiff does so after speaking with her friends, without the footballer “giving her the way or opening the door”.
Furthermore, the appeal filed requesting the release of Alves states that “it is the moment before the sexual encounter in the tiny cubicle or bathroom one entered first, then the other. And that the plaintiff describes and expresses as lived in a climate of terror, dread or microcosm of domination, a scenario that the images deny in the most radical way adding that the images cast doubt on whether the sex was consensual or forced.
